We are looking for Developers to join our client’s team. As a Senior Software Engineer, you will join one of our client's small, fast-paced, agile delivery teams, using agile methodology and DevOps techniques to build backend systems, data processing pipelines, and progressive web apps for customers in the UK Government and Defence sector.
Responsibilities
* Implementing software solutions including design, development, and testing.
* Using a wide range of technologies, specialising in the use of open-source libraries and components.
* Using tools such as GitLab to build continuous integration pipelines, helping monitor and ensure software quality and security.
* Deploying software systems to various environments including public (AWS and Azure) and private cloud.
* Full Software Lifecycle involvement:
* Project concept formalization
* Requirement analysis and specification
* Software architecture design
* Software implementation and delivery
* Software training and support
* Software lifecycle and maintenance
